Millicent National Trust Museum
Millicent National Trust Museum is a museum in Wattle Range Council, South Australia which is located on Princes Highway. Millicent National Trust Museum is situated nearby to the tourism office Millicent Information Centre, as well as near Wind Turbine Blade.Places in the Area

Millicent is a town in the Australian state of South Australia located about 399 kilometres south-east of the state capital of Adelaide and about 50 kilometres north of the regional centre of Mount Gambier.
